Report text boxes

Is there a way to resize/expand/reduce text boxes in reports so that nearby text boxes automatically reshape (so that text does not overlap in the print view)?

I work with letters (in reports) that need to be updated every few months, and which vary according to certain conditions. As a result, the report has a number of text boxes overlapping, making it difficult to resize a text box that needs editing, without manually changing other text boxes, or checking that other versions of the letter derived from the same report do not have overlapping text in the print view.

RE: Report text boxes

Hi Shamini,

Thank you for your post, welcome to the forum.

In answer to your question, you can set the properties of the text box (Control) to Grow and/or Shrink in relation to the amount of text being entered. the Grow and Shrink is only available as an adjustment to the height of the text box not the width.

On your report, change to Design view, right click the control you wish to work on and from the Properties list choose Format, in the list of options find Can Grow and Can Shrink, change these both to Yes and close your Properties list, change back to Print View and observe the field, where text is long Access has wrapped it within the width of the field and changed the height to fit, moving all other records proportionally.

Using the Quick Access Toolbar in Access 2010

The Quick Access Toolbar is included in virtually every Office product, including Outlook 2010, Word 2010, Excel 2010, and PowerPoint 2010.

You will find the Quick Access Toolbar in the top-left side of the window. To begin, click the Customize button (it's the little black arrow at the end of the toolbar).

Simply click the commands you want to include.

Virtually any command can be added to the Quick Access Toolbar. Click the More Commands option and a new window will open from where you can browse the commands including those not on the ribbon.
